Since I’m staying in Centro, I’ve been trying restaurants and comidas I don’t normally get a chance to try. They are all around me – why not?
Magari is a Japanese cafe similar to a small restaurant you might find in the interior of Japan. It is in the same building as Maria Bonita – the restaurant I tried a few days ago. The chef is a young lady from Japan and the menu is varied and good. It is good, the place and the people are relaxing. And the cup of hot ginger tea I had after my lunch was a very special finish.
